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the colour consultant sector.
Junior Interior Designer
A Junior Interior Designer collaborates with clients to create concepts, prepares sketches, mood boards, sources decor, and communicates with stakeholders.
Interior Designer
An Interior Designer develops concepts for indoor spaces by collaborating with clients, considering aesthetics, trends, and budgets.
Interior Stylist
An Interior Stylist enhances the aesthetic of spaces by creating concepts, sourcing decor, and communicating client needs while staying current with trends.
Furniture Designer
A Furniture Designer creates plans and prototypes for furniture, customising designs to meet client needs while considering trends and materials.
Kitchen Designer
A Kitchen Designer creates kitchen layouts, takes measurements, sources materials, and collaborates with builders, requiring creativity, organisation, and stakeholder communication.
Bathroom Designer
A Bathroom Designer creates layouts, sources materials, and liaises with clients and builders, requiring creativity, attention to detail, and knowledge of bathroom trends.
Design Coordinator
A Design Coordinator manages design concepts for interiors and exteriors, liaising with clients, creating plans, and focusing on trends and styling.
Interior Design Consultant
Interior Design Consultants create and decorate indoor spaces for residential and commercial clients, using design software and collaborating with tradespeople.
Commercial Interior Designer
A Commercial Interior Designer creates and develops interior spaces for businesses, requiring design skills, project management, and industry knowledge.
Property Stylist
Property Stylists enhance residential properties' appeal by arranging decor and furniture to attract potential buyers or renters.
Interior Architect
An Interior Architect designs and optimises interior spaces for functionality and aesthetics, collaborating with clients and teams to meet project needs.
Design Consultant
A Design Consultant works with clients to create functional and appealing designs, developing concepts and overseeing project implementation.
Design Manager
A Design Manager leads design projects across various industries, coordinating teams, managing resources, and ensuring client needs are met.
